Seite 72 - Antimony is a bright bluish-white coloured metal crystallizing in rhombohedrons, isomorphous with arsenic. It is very brittle, and can be powdered in a mortar ; it melts at 450°, and may be distilled at a white heat in an atmosphere of hydrogen. Antimony undergoes no alteration in the air at ordinary temperatures, but rapidly oxidizes if exposed to air when melted, and, if heated more strongly, it takes fire and burns with a white flame, giving off dense white funies of antimony trioxide.

Seite 58 - ... communicating a green tint to a flame of hydrogen gas, which is passed over it, and it is one of the best conductors of heat and electricity. Copper does not oxidize either in pure dry or moist air at ordinary temperatures, but if heated to redness in the air, it rapidly oxidizes to scales of copper oxide.

Seite 37 - ... madder or litmus, in a bottle of dry chlorine, and no change of colour takes place, even after the lapse of many weeks : if, however, a few drops of water are added, the colouring matter is immediately destroyed, and the cotton or paper is bleached. Here the chlorine combines with the hydrogen of the water, and the oxygen at the moment of its liberation (when it is said to be nascent) combines with the vegetable colouring matters, forming compounds destitute of colour.
